GM puts Girsky in charge of Europe operations
Thu, 12 Jul 2012General Motors has put vice chairman Steve Girsky in charge of its troubled European operations, replacing Karl-Friedrich Stracke. GM said that Stracke will handle special assignments from chairman Dan Akerson. GM said Girsky will serve as "acting head" of its European operations while it searches for a replacement executive.
Future products: Buick sees 6 to 7 models in its lineup for 2011-13
Thu, 12 Aug 2010A Buick LaCrosse hybrid sedan probably will join a new small car and new crossover as Buick expands its lineup in the next three model years. The brand, which sells four nameplates now, eventually wants a six- or seven-vehicle lineup, says John Schwegman, Buick-GMC's top marketer. Buick seeks to revive its reputation for performance and stylish luxury to appeal to middle-aged professionals who often buy Asian luxury brands.
LaFerrari joins Supercar exhibition at Ferrari Museum in Maranello
Mon, 11 Mar 2013The new LaFerrari has joined an exhibition of supercars at Ferrari’s Maranello Museum joining cars like the 250 GTO, F40, F50 and Enzo Ferrari. Ferrari boss, Luca di Montezemolo, has opened the Supercar exhibition in Maranello to showcase Ferrari’s greatest models all in one place, an opportunity Ferraristi will find hard to resist. As well as LaFerrari, Ferrari has on show perhaps the greatest supercar in their history – the Ferrari 250 GTO – which was built in very limited numbers – just 33 Series 1 and 3 Series 2 cars – and now commands prices around the $40 million mark, the 288 GTO, the F40 – perhaps the ‘Driver’s’ choice – the F50 and, of course, the Enzo Ferrari.
